Key Insights of Japan Lip Makeup Market

  • Market Size (2023): Estimated at approximately $1.2 billion, reflecting steady growth driven by premium and mass segments.
  • Forecast Value (2026): Projected to reach $1.5 billion, with a CAGR of around 6% from 2023 to 2026.
  • Dominant Segment: Lipsticks remain the leading product category, accounting for over 60% of sales, with a rising trend in lip gloss and tint variants.
  • Core Application: Primarily driven by daily wear and special occasion makeup, with a notable shift towards long-lasting and nourishing formulations.
  • Leading Geography: Tokyo Metropolitan Area dominates with approximately 45% market share, followed by Osaka and Nagoya regions.
  • Market Opportunity: Growing demand for eco-friendly, cruelty-free, and innovative textures presents significant expansion potential.
  • Major Companies: Shiseido, Kanebo, and Kosé lead the market, with emerging brands focusing on natural ingredients and digital-first marketing.

Emerging Trends and Innovation Opportunities in Japan Lip Makeup Market

Recent trends in Japan’s lip makeup landscape include a surge in natural, organic, and cruelty-free formulations, aligning with global sustainability movements. Consumers are increasingly seeking multifunctional products that combine color, hydration, and skincare benefits, such as lip tints infused with antioxidants or SPF protection. The rise of digital influencers and social media campaigns has amplified demand for trendy, limited-edition collections, fostering a culture of immediacy and exclusivity.

Technological innovations like 3D printing for customized lip products and augmented reality (AR) try-on tools are transforming consumer engagement. Brands are also investing in sustainable packaging solutions, biodegradable materials, and refillable formats to appeal to eco-conscious buyers. The market presents opportunities for brands to develop personalized, clean-label, and innovative textures that cater to evolving aesthetic and ethical standards, ensuring long-term growth and differentiation.
